Our take

Madonna opens with a surprisingly sharp slap of davana and rum, a boozy, herbal hit that cuts through the air like a glass of dark honeyed liqueur spilled over fresh sage. That initial fizz is brief, though, before the white floral coalition takes over: tuberose, osmanthus, jasmine sambac, and orange blossom stack up like a gilded wall of petals, all creamy density and barely checked sweetness. The drydown settles into a warm, slightly gritty base of ambergris, black pepper, and Haitian vetiver, with patchouli and sandalwood smoothing the edges into something that feels both soft and dirty. This is not a shy fragrance. It’s a marble conservatory after a sudden downpour, the flowers dripping with spiced rum and animalic musk, the air thick and humid. The sillage is moderate rather than nuclear, and longevity sits at a respectable but not heroic three and a half hours, so you will need to reapply. Madonna suits a woman who dresses for herself on a spring afternoon, someone unafraid of heavy white florals and a touch of synthetic drama. Skip it if you prefer transparent scents or find tuberose cloying. Best worn for a leisurely lunch or a daytime event where you want to leave a lingering, slightly intoxicating impression.
